Building a Fog light harness on 92 RS

I have a 1992 RS that did not come stock with fog lights... I have aquired a set of factory fog light bezels and the grill insert but now I have to wire them . Has anyone built a harness? Does anyone have wire size suggestions , bulb selection preference, or any other ideas that will help me? Thanks in advance, nick

Re: Building a Fog light harness on 92 RS

I went and did this on my current Camaro. I believe I used 12 gage wire. light bulb I cant remember. What I did is on a video posted on youtube. mind you my wires hook to a separate switch instead of the stock switch and didnt put them in through the firewall.

You can see my video as reference if you'd like but there is better ways to do it.
In there I explained the relay and what the wires should hook to for the fan. The fan and fog lights I ran the same way. This is before I removed the cables so it might look messy lol. Read the description or just ask and I'll answer any questions I can.
